Maintaining drones is essential for ensuring their optimal performance and longevity. This article highlights the importance of regular maintenance and the practices that operators should adopt.
Conducting regular inspections is crucial for identifying potential issues before they escalate. Operators should check the drone's structure, electronics, and software to ensure everything is functioning correctly.
The battery is one of the most critical components of a drone. Proper battery care, including charging habits and storage, can significantly impact flight times and overall performance.
Keeping drone firmware and software updated is vital for optimal functionality. Manufacturers frequently release updates that enhance performance, add new features, and improve security.
Regular cleaning of drones helps maintain their performance. Operators should remove dirt and debris from the drone after each flight and store it in a safe, dry location to prevent damage.
By prioritizing drone maintenance, operators can ensure their UAVs perform at their best for extended periods. Regular care not only improves flight performance but also prolongs the lifespan of the equipment.
